What is Knudson’s 2 hit hypothesis?
That most tumor suppressor genes require both alleles to be inactivated (recessively acting cancer gene), either through mutations or through epigenetic silencing, to cause a phenotypic change (cancer development). This was proven with the Rb1 locus (retinoblastoma tumor suppressor gene). Homozygous loss of the wild-type Rb1 locus correlated with retinoblastoma development.

What is the Hayflick limit?
The eventual loss of replicative potential (cellular senescence). The time to the cessation of cell division correlates closely with critically eroded telomeres (called telomere signal-free ends).

List the stages of apoptosis
- Rounding up of the cell
- Plasma membrane blebbing
- Cytoplasm shrinkage
- Alteration of membrane asymmetry
- Condensation and fragmentation of the nucleus
Late stage: fragmented into apoptotic bodies that are eliminated by phagocytic cells without triggering inflammation.
What is the action of RANKL
Receptor activator of nuclear factor kappa betta ligand (RANKL) is released by osteoblasts. It activates myeloid progenitor cells to differentiate into osteoclasts that can digest bone structures, creating space for establishment of metastasis. Denosumab is a monoclonal Ab targeting RANKL, approved for treating patients with bone metastasis.

What is the action of DNA methylation
Covalent addition of a methyl group at position 5 of a cytosine (C) nucleotide (5mC), typically positioned close to a guanine residue (G), occuring mostly in CpG islands (regions dense in adjacent C and G nucleotides) found at the promoter region of genes. Typically results in gene-SILENCING.

What are the solvents used for paclitaxel and docetaxel respectively that allow for IV administration?
Paclitaxel = Cremophor EL, Docetaxel + Polysorbate 80
These solvents cause severe hypersensitivity reactions in dogs and require significant pretreatment with antihistamines and steroids and prolonged infusion with continued monitoring.
New water soluble formulation of paclitaxel (Paccal Vet) may lead to increased use of this drug in vet med.

Why is cyclophosphamide relatively platelet sparing?
High levels of aldehyde dehydrogenase in the bone marrow (which deactivates cyclophosphamide)
